#6c2652 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6c2652 is composed of 42.4% red, 14.9%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.8% magenta, 24.1%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 322.3 degrees, a saturation of 47.9% and a lightness of 28.6%. #6c2652 color hex could be obtained by blending #d84ca4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

● #6c2652 color description : Very dark pink.
#6c2652 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6c2652 has RGB values of R:108, G:38,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.65, Y:0.24,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 7087698.

Shades and Tints of #6c2652
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060205 is the darkest color, while #fcf7f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#6c2652
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4a4849 is the less saturated color, while #8e045b is the most saturated one.
